Comments:
A designated Ramsar site of significant international importance for wildlife. It is a man-made marsh with a diversity of habitats.

Comments:

From Table A.4, estimated number of breeding Western grebes during nesting period based on mazimum observed count from 1970 to 1990 (sourced from Wilson, A. and Smith, P.A. 2013. Distribution and population status of Western Grebes in Canada. Unpublished report for the Canadian Wildlife Service). No break out of data per year or other details.
